Mobility Print

Overview

Mobility Print allows users to print from any personal mobile device running Windows, macOS, iOS, Andriod & ChromeOS.

Getting Started

Mobility Print: Setup and Use

  1. Connect to the College Wi-Fi network. (Student or Staff)
  2. Follow the device specific instructions here:
    https://www.papercut.com/support/resources/manuals/mobility-print/mobility-print-devices/topics/en/client-setup.html
  3. Print normally as you would from any desktop or mobile application.  (Note: not all mobile applications have a “print” feature.)

Please note: any mention of "PaperCut username/password" is to replaced with your myCampus credentials.

Which Printers Support Mobility Print?

Most printers in common laptop use areas such as the Learning Commons, Library and computer labs are available via mobility print.  Note the printer name label affixed to each printer, it’s similar to the room number.  Also look for a mobility print sticker or poster nearby.

Not all College printers are accessible via mobility print. For a full list of available printers, please visit the "Mobility Printing" link below.  

Troubleshooting

Q: How do I add more printers after the initial setup?

A: Please go through the app installation again, it will prompt you to add additional printers.

Q: Why can I not connect to the printers when installing Mobility Print?

A: Make sure you are connected to the Student or Staff WiFi network. Guest does not support Mobility Print
